Half Moon Cookies


Ingredients:
1/2 c. soft butter
1 c. sugar
1 egg
1 tsp. vanilla
1 c. milk
2 c. flour
1/2 tsp. baking powder
1 1/2 tsp. baking soda
1/2 tsp. salt
1/2 c. cocoa
Mix all ingredients together in order given. Beat until smooth. Drop by rounded tablespoonfuls onto greased cookie sheet, allowing 2-inches of space between cookies to allow for spreading.Bake in a preheated 400°F oven for about 7 minutes. Cool and frost half of each cookie with vanilla icing and half with chocolate icing.
(you can also use white chocolate or white almond bark) and dark chocolate or regular almond bark)
Yield: 2 dozen.
                                                                                                                            
WHITE FROSTING:
Combine 2 tablespoons butter, 1/2 teaspoon vanilla and 2 cups powdered sugar. Add milk and moisten.
CHOCOLATE FROSTING:
Same ingredients but add 2 tablespoons cocoa.

Homemade Chocolate's 
·       2 cups of coco powder
·       3/4 cups butter
·       3/4 cups cain sugar
·       1/2 powdered sugar
·       2/3 cup milk
·       1/4 cup of flower
Step 1: place cocoa and butter in mixer and mix until it is a paste
Step 2: Roll paste into small balls
Step 3: Fill a pot ¼ of the way with water and place the balls in to the water and warm up them up
Step 4: strain out balls and place them back in mixer and mix until smooth.
Step 5: add sugar, milk, and flower into the mixer and mix well
Step 6: after it is mixed well pour into molds or ice trays and place in refrigerator until hardened.  
Yields: 28 chocolates if using ice trays could yield more if using molds
